About Elspeth MacRae

Elspeth MacRae is a scholar working on Plant Science, Food Science and Biotechnology, having authored 99 papers that have together received 5.5k indexed citations. Recurring topics across this work include Plant Physiology and Cultivation Studies (46 papers), Postharvest Quality and Shelf Life Management (44 papers) and Polysaccharides and Plant Cell Walls (18 papers). The work is most often cited by research in Plant Science (4.7k citations), Biochemistry (666 citations) and Food Science (819 citations). Elspeth MacRae has collaborated with scholars based in New Zealand, Australia and United Kingdom. Frequent co-authors include Ian B. Ferguson, Brian D. Patterson, Ian C. Hallett, T Wegrzyn, Robert J. Redgwell, Ken Marsh, Monica Fischer, Ross G. Atkinson, John E. Lunn and F. Roger Harker. Their work appears in journals such as Proceedings of the National Academy of Sciences, PLANT PHYSIOLOGY and Analytical Biochemistry.
